UNPKG

@react-md/menu

Version:

Create menus that auto-position themselves within the viewport and adhere to the accessibility guidelines

18 lines 642 B
"use strict"; Object.defineProperty(exports, "__esModule", { value: true }); exports.MenuEvents = void 0; var utils_1 = require("@react-md/utils"); /** * This is just a simple component that is used with the `Menu` component to * handle the initial focus on mount and re-focusing a previous element on * unmount. * @private */ function MenuEvents(_a) { var menuRef = _a.menuRef, cancelled = _a.cancelled, defaultFocus = _a.defaultFocus; utils_1.usePreviousFocus(cancelled); utils_1.useFocusOnMount(menuRef, defaultFocus, false, true); return null; } exports.MenuEvents = MenuEvents; //# sourceMappingURL=MenuEvents.js.map